Green-Software-Foundation / projects

The Green Software Foundation's Projects repository
Creative Commons Attribution 4.0 International
0 stars 4 forks source link

[Agenda Item] Lifecycle Stage Change Approval Process #76

Closed Sophietn closed 7 months ago

Sophietn commented 8 months ago

Overview: The Oversight Committee is the 'Approving body' for Software Projects progressing from Incubation > Graduated.

This is the Approval Process from the Software Project Lifecycle Documentation. Projects seeking to reach Graduated Stage must submit an issue to the Oversight Committee repo. GSF PM (and Project Leads) should meet with the Oversight Committee to showcase their project meets the acceptance criteria below for Graduation consensus approval.

Acceptance Criteria to Graduate The project must meet the Incubation requirements as well as the following:

This Agenda item is to discuss what this should look like in practice.

Related topic: The type of agenda item you want to propose.

Related working groups:

Related issues or discussions: https://github.com/Green-Software-Foundation/oc/issues/23 https://github.com/Green-Software-Foundation/oc/issues/56

More information:

Any other information you want to add.

Sophietn commented 7 months ago

We didn't discuss this agenda item on the 6th Feb Oversight Committee, as we had only 3 attendees.

Below outlines the proposed approach we will take, unless we hear an objection.

We will raise an issue on the OC repo with all the links out to the project repo showcasing fulfilment of the Graduated lifecycle stage acceptance criteria. The issue will ask for a Motion to move the project from Incubation to Graduated lifecycle stage.

Sophietn commented 7 months ago

No objections received - closing out this issue.